Link mode uses simple connectors for low voltage connections. These
connections are color coded which makes the installation easier and
quicker.

Do the following to make the connections from the actual thermostat
wire to the connector.
Note: These connectors are necessary for the Outdoor unit, Indoor
unit and Distribution board.
1.
Strip the Red, White, Green and Blue thermostat wires back 1/4".
2.
Insert the wires into the connector in the correctly colored
locations.
3.
When you feel it release, allow each wire to slide in
further.
4.
Pull back on the wires individually and slightly and check if the
wires are seated properly. If each wire does not pull out for all four
wires, the connection is complete.
5.
Connectors are ONE TIME USE. If a 18 ga. Thermostat wire gets
broken off inside of the connector, the connector will need
replaced.
6.
Wire colors are for illustration purposes only. If using a different
color, ensure it lands at the correct terminal throughout all of the
communicating control wiring.
Connect the CAN connector into the male coupling on the low voltage
harness at the Outdoor unit.
